What the Speaker Placement Calculator does

The Speaker Placement Calculator is a practical planning tool that helps you estimate the recommended front wall distance for your left and right speakers. By combining your room width, room length, listening distance, speaker type, and placement style, it produces a useful starting point for building a balanced stereo setup.

This is especially helpful when you want to place speakers in a way that supports:

  • Balanced stereo imaging
  • Clear center soundstage
  • Improved bass integration
  • Reduced boundary interference
  • More consistent placement decisions for different room sizes

The result label, Front Wall Distance, refers to how far your speakers should be placed from the wall behind them. This distance can strongly affect how your system sounds, because speakers placed too close to the front wall may create boomy bass or blurred detail, while speakers placed too far forward may not blend well with the room. Using a speaker placement calculator gives you a smart starting point instead of guessing.

Whether you are setting up a home theater, a music room, a studio desk, or a dedicated listening space, this tool helps simplify the process. It does not replace listening tests or acoustic treatment, but it gives you a dependable estimate that can save time and improve results.

How to use the Speaker Placement Calculator

Using the Speaker Placement Calculator is straightforward. The goal is to enter the basic characteristics of your room and setup so the calculator can estimate an appropriate starting distance from the front wall.

  1. Enter the room width in feet. This helps describe the overall shape of the room, which affects stereo spread and side-wall relationships.
  2. Enter the room length in feet. Room length is a major factor because it influences how far speakers can sit from the front wall and how sound waves develop in the space.
  3. Enter your listening distance in feet. This is the distance from your main listening position to the speaker line.
  4. Select the speaker type. Different speaker types may need different placement distances because of size, bass output, and dispersion patterns.
  5. Select the placement style. This adjusts the estimate based on whether you want a more conservative, moderate, or flexible placement approach.

After you input the values, the calculator returns a Front Wall Distance recommendation. Use that number as your first placement attempt, then fine-tune by listening.

A good workflow looks like this:

  • Measure your room carefully.
  • Input the numbers into the calculator.
  • Move the speakers to the suggested distance.
  • Listen to familiar music or test tracks.
  • Make small adjustments of 1 to 3 inches if needed.

This approach is useful because acoustic performance often depends on real-world behavior, not just theory. The calculator gives you a data-based launch point, and your ears help you finalize the setup.

How the Speaker Placement Calculator formula works

The formula used by the Speaker Placement Calculator is:

((room_length_ft * 0.22) + (listening_distance_ft * 0.08)) * speaker_type * placement_style

The output is the Front Wall Distance. Here is what each part means:

  • room_length_ft * 0.22 — This gives room length a strong influence on speaker distance. Longer rooms generally allow speakers to sit farther from the front wall.
  • listening_distance_ft * 0.08 — Your listening distance also matters, but with a smaller weight. This helps align speaker placement with the listening triangle.
  • speaker_type — This multiplier adjusts for different speaker characteristics. For example, larger speakers or models with stronger low-frequency output may need more space.
  • placement_style — This multiplier reflects how aggressively or conservatively you want to position the speakers.

To better understand the logic, imagine a room that is 20 feet long and a listening distance of 10 feet:

  • 20 × 0.22 = 4.4
  • 10 × 0.08 = 0.8
  • Base estimate = 5.2 feet

If the selected speaker type multiplier is 1.0 and the placement style multiplier is 1.0, the estimated Front Wall Distance would be 5.2 feet. If either multiplier is higher or lower, the final distance changes accordingly.

This formula is designed to be simple, practical, and flexible. It does not try to solve every acoustic issue. Instead, it offers a useful estimate based on the most important placement variables.

Use cases for the Speaker Placement Calculator

The Speaker Placement Calculator is useful in many different listening environments. Whether you are optimizing sound for entertainment or accuracy, it helps create a more deliberate setup process.

Common use cases include:

  • Home stereo systems — Place bookshelf or floorstanding speakers more confidently for music listening.
  • Home theaters — Establish a clear front soundstage and improve dialogue placement.
  • Dedicated listening rooms — Create a balanced stereo triangle with accurate front wall spacing.
  • Studio nearfield setups — Find a practical speaker distance for monitors near a desk or console.
  • Multi-purpose rooms — Adapt speaker placement when the room must serve several functions.

This tool is also useful when comparing different speaker models. For example, if you are deciding between compact monitors and larger towers, the calculator can help you estimate whether one model will be easier to position in your room. It is also helpful when moving into a new space and you need a fast way to establish a sensible layout before making permanent decisions.

Another strong use case is room correction preparation. Before applying EQ or digital room correction, it is smart to get the physical placement close to ideal. Speaker positioning has a major impact on sound quality, and no amount of processing can fully replace good placement.

Other factors to consider when calculating Front Wall Distance

While the Speaker Placement Calculator provides a valuable estimate, the final result should always be checked against real room conditions. Several other factors can influence how your speakers actually sound and where they should be placed.

  • Wall construction — Solid walls, drywall, and reflective surfaces all affect bass behavior differently.
  • Furniture and objects — Sofas, racks, shelves, and tables can reflect or absorb sound.
  • Speaker design — Rear-ported, front-ported, sealed, and open-baffle designs may all react differently to wall proximity.
  • Room symmetry — Uneven side boundaries can shift the stereo image and make one speaker sound different from the other.
  • Listening height — Tweeter alignment with ear level often matters as much as distance from the wall.
  • Toe-in angle — Turning the speakers inward can sharpen imaging and reduce side-wall reflections.
  • Acoustic treatment — Bass traps, absorption panels, and diffusers can improve placement flexibility.

It is also important to remember that the front wall distance is only one part of the setup. You should also evaluate:

  • Distance between speakers
  • Distance to the listening position
  • Distance from side walls
  • Angle and orientation of each speaker

A well-placed pair of speakers should create a convincing stereo image with a stable center and even tonal balance. If the sound is too heavy in the bass, reduce wall proximity. If the sound feels thin or lacks body, try moving the speakers slightly closer to the front wall. Small changes can make a noticeable difference.

For best results, use the calculator as a starting point, then make careful adjustments based on listening. The strongest setups usually come from combining measurement, calculation, and practical listening.

Frequently Asked Questions

What is a speaker placement calculator used for?

A speaker placement calculator helps estimate where speakers should sit in a room, especially their distance from the front wall. It is useful for creating a balanced stereo triangle and improving sound quality before you start fine-tuning by ear.

Does the speaker placement calculator work for all speaker types?

Yes, it can be used for many types of speakers, including bookshelf speakers, floorstanding speakers, and studio monitors. However, the result should be treated as a starting point, since each speaker design reacts differently to room boundaries.

Why does front wall distance matter so much?

Front wall distance affects bass response, clarity, and imaging. If speakers are too close to the wall, low frequencies can build up and muddy the sound. If they are too far from the wall, they may not integrate well with the room or your listening position.

Can I use the calculator for a home theater setup?

Absolutely. The Speaker Placement Calculator can help you estimate front speaker positioning in a home theater, especially for the left and right speakers. It is a useful tool for creating a strong front soundstage.

Should I trust the calculator result exactly?

The result should be viewed as a practical guideline, not a strict rule. Room acoustics, furniture, wall materials, and speaker design can all change the final best placement. Use the result as your first setup, then adjust based on listening tests.
